2023-10-19 17:21:45 +02:00
|
|
|
#pragma once
|
|
|
|
|
2023-10-19 23:52:11 +02:00
|
|
|
struct SimpleConfigModel;
|
2023-10-19 17:21:45 +02:00
|
|
|
|
|
|
|
class SettingsWindow {
|
|
|
|
bool _show_window {false};
|
2023-10-19 23:52:11 +02:00
|
|
|
// TODO: add iteration api to interface
|
|
|
|
SimpleConfigModel& _conf;
|
2023-10-19 17:21:45 +02:00
|
|
|
|
|
|
|
public:
|
2023-10-19 23:52:11 +02:00
|
|
|
SettingsWindow(SimpleConfigModel& conf);
|
2023-10-19 17:21:45 +02:00
|
|
|
|
|
|
|
void render(void);
|
|
|
|
};
|
|
|
|
|